## Deploying the Gatewick Proctor Queue

Deploys are pretty painless: push to main, wait for the pipeline, then watch the queue drain dashboard for five minutes. If candidates pile up mid-exam, roll back first and ask questions later — the queue replays safely. Everything the workers care about lives in one config block, shown here for reference.

settings of bafof-yagef:
JOROX_PIN=8740
JOROX_TENANT=pelox
JOROX_METRICS_HOST=metrics.jorox.qorvelworks.internal
JOROX_SEAL=seal_c78f63c1
JOROX_STANDBY_TEAM=norax

Facilities Ticket — Cleaning Crew Access, Brindle Annex

For new starters handling evening lock-up: the Sorano Cleaning crew arrives nightly at 21:30 via the annex side door. Check their rota sheet, note arrival in the log, and ensure the storeroom is relocked afterward. To let them through the side door, enter the access code below.

badge for yaweg-hafog: bdg-GX-6

## Authentication

Hey plugin folks! Before your extension can talk to SnackRoute's restock planner, you'll need to authenticate against our internal inventory gateway. Every request has to carry a key in the `X-SnackRoute-Key` header — no key, no vending data, sorry. Keys are scoped per plugin, so don't share them between projects, and definitely don't commit them anywhere public. For local testing against the staging machines fleet, use the key below.

gateway credential: kto3_qfe